We decided to take a day cruise out of Seward to see some of Alaska's sites. We had a beautiful drive down with all the Aspen, Birch, and Cottonwood turning yellow. Carmen and Billy got to see the undescribable color of the glacier fed lakes and rivers.This was taken of our drive through Turnagain Arm.We went on the only cruise that was still open for the season. We went on the Kenai Fjord boat through Resurrection Bay. The captain warned us that the water was a little choppy so told us the best places to sit. Kaden and Grandpa Billy watching for caving of the glacier. Caving is when a piece of the glacier falls off into the water. We saw some great splashes! It was crazy hearing the errie sounds of the glacier.
